HT1655 how do you remove music from ipod shuffle?

I'm so frustrated with the newer iTunes application.  Does anyone know how to remove downloads from the ipod shuffle? I'm not finding any instructions on iTunes or in the ipod shuffle manual.

It depends on the shuffle model, and if you are using automatic syncing to load the shuffle, or the manual (drag and drop items to the shuffle in iTunes) method.
This document shows the four types (and also explains the methods available to load a shuffle with songs)
http://support.apple.com/kb/HT1719
If I assume you have the current 4th (or 3rd) gen shuffle, and you have been loading songs manually...
First, the latest iTunes many hide the sidebar.  To show the sidebar, from the menu bar, under View, select Show Sidebar.
Select the shuffle in the sidebar, under DEVICES.  Click the toggle (small triangle to the left of shuffle) to drop down its content list, indented under the shuffle.  Select Music there.  Over to the right, there is a list of songs currently on the shuffle.  Select the song you want to remove and press Delete on keyboard.  You can do this with one song, a selection of songs, or the entiire list (Select All from the Edit menu).
If you have a 1st or 2nd gen shuffle, or use automatic syncing with a 3rd or 4th gen shuffle, please post back.

  • How do you transfer music from IPOD to New Computer

    What do you do if you get a new computer? Itunes says IPOD is synced with another library and will not transfer music.

    If you are using iTunes version 7 or later, then you can transfer purchased iTunes store music from the iPod to an authorized computer by using the "file/transfer purchases from iPod" menu. Note that the maximum of 5 authorized computers applies here.
    For all other non purchased music (your own CDs etc) try this method which works on some Windows PCs.
    Enable your iPod for disk use.
    See: iPod Disk Use.
    Open iTunes and select edit/preferences/advanced/general. Put a check mark in the box marked "copy files to iTunes music folder when adding to library" and also "keep iTunes music folder organized", then click 'ok'.
    Connect the iPod whilst holding down the shift/ctrl keys to prevent any auto sync, and if you see the dialogue window asking if you want to sync to this itunes library, click 'no'.
    Then go to file/add folder, open 'my computer', select your iPod and click 'ok'.
    The music files should transfer to your iTunes.
    If this doesn't work (and it may not because officially it's not supposed to), check out the instructions/suggestions here.
    Music from iPod to computer (using option 2). This a manual method using "hidden folders" and although it works, it can be messy.
    Much easier ways are to use one of the many 3rd party programs that copy music from the iPod to the computer.
    One of the most recommended is Yamipod. This is a free program that transfers music from iPod back to the computer. However, it does not transfer playcounts/ratings etc.
    Another free program is Pod Player.
